Chapter 2: Trouble in the Market Episode

A few days later, Daniel decided to take the parrots with him to the market so that people could see how clever they were. The town square was crowded as usual. People were bargaining over prices, laughing, and discussing the news of the day. Daniel walked proudly with the cage in his hands. Suddenly, one of the parrots flapped her wings and shouted loudly, “Hello everyone! We’re prostitutes! Let’s have a nice time!” The entire market froze. Before Daniel could react, the second parrot added loudly, “Yes! Come and enjoy with us!” A shocked silence spread through the crowd. Then whispers began. “What did that bird say?” “Did you hear that?” Some people stared at Daniel with disbelief, while others began laughing loudly. A woman shook her head in disapproval, and an old man looked at Daniel as if he had committed a terrible crime. Daniel’s face turned red with embarrassment. “Oh no… not again,” he whispered. He tried to cover the cage with a cloth, but the parrots continued repeating their strange message to everyone who passed by. Daniel hurried away from the market, wishing the ground would swallow him.
